New Features in Version 3.5.10
Tempo track import
When importing tempo tracks, you can now choose to import into a new ow instead of an
existing ow. See Importing tempo tracks.
Figured bass improvements
The gured bass popover now accepts and interprets more entries, including double and
triple accidentals and the overall and suspension durations of gured bass gures. See
Figured bass popover.
Text improvements
You can now align individual text objects with the start of systems. See Aligning text objects
with the start of systems.
Deleting and renaming endpoint congurations
There is a new Edit Endpoint Congurations dialog that allows you to rename and delete
custom endpoint congurations. It also displays the plug-ins and players contained in each
endpoint conguration. See Edit Endpoint Congurations dialog.
Expression map playback options overrides
You can now override individual playback options in each expression map independently.
See Expression Maps dialog.
Guitar post-bends
You can now show post-bends, including microtonal post-bends, on notes belonging to
fretted instruments. See Guitar post-bends.
New Features in Version 3.5.0
Highlights
Properties panel control
New options have been added to the top of the Properties panel, allowing you to search
and lter properties, making it easier to nd properties for items with many possible
groups. See Properties panel (Write mode).
You can now change the property scope for local properties, allowing you to specify in
advance that you want subsequent changes to affect all layouts and frame chains. See
Changing the property scope.
Pitch before duration note input
You can now input notes by selecting or playing the pitch rst and only inputting the note
once you select the duration afterwards. See Inputting notes using pitch before duration.
Alongside pitch before duration input, you can change whether any rhythm dots,
accidentals, and articulations you select apply to the last input note or the next note you
input. See Changing the note-based notation input setting.
